Indoor HVAC unit types are important components of a climate control system that provide heating, air flow, and air conditioning. Understanding the different types and their features can significantly improve home consolation, efficiency, and total indoor air quality. As the demand for efficient heating and cooling methods grows, producers have developed numerous forms of indoor HVAC units to meet numerous wants.


One common sort of indoor HVAC unit is the split system air conditioner. This type sometimes consists of two main components: an out of doors compressor and an indoor evaporator. The evaporator distributes cooled air throughout the home by way of ducts. Split techniques are popular due to their efficiency and decrease noise ranges compared to window units. They may also be configured in multi-zone setups, where a quantity of indoor items join to a minimum of one outdoor unit, allowing totally different temperature settings in varied areas.

Another prevalent choice is the packaged HVAC unit. Unlike split systems, all components of a packaged unit are contained in a single cupboard, often installed on the roof or on a concrete slab outside the home. They present both heating and cooling capabilities, making them perfect for properties with limited indoor space for putting in separate indoor models. Packaged units are known for his or her ease of installation and maintenance.


Ductless mini-split methods have gained traction in recent years, especially in renovations and older constructions missing ductwork. These techniques encompass an out of doors compressor and one or more indoor air handlers that are mounted on walls or ceilings. Ductless mini-splits provide flexibility in installation and allow homeowners to manage temperatures in individual rooms. This zoning functionality can result in significant power savings.

Another type of indoor HVAC unit is the central air conditioning system, which makes use of ductwork to distribute cooled air all through the home. This system usually operates at the side of a furnace or heat pump. Central air conditioning is especially environment friendly for larger properties, as it could effectively cool multiple rooms concurrently. Proper insulation and sealing are crucial for optimizing the performance of a central AC system.


Radiant heating techniques serve as an different selection to traditional HVAC models, using sizzling water or electric mats put in beneath flooring to heat spaces. This methodology offers even heat distribution and can be paired with a central system for added efficiency. Radiant heating items are particularly advantageous in colder climates, as they remove drafts and ensure consistent temperatures.

Heat pumps are versatile and serve both heating and cooling needs by way of the identical unit. They extract heat from the outside air or ground, transferring it indoors throughout winter and reversing the process in summer. Heat pumps are extremely efficient and can cut back power consumption considerably. These techniques are perfect for climates that don't experience extreme chilly, although they may require supplemental heating in harsh winters.

Indoor air quality is a big concern for owners, and air purifiers are essential to address this problem. These systems work to get rid of mud, allergens, and pollution from the indoor environment. Modern air purifiers typically combine with HVAC techniques, providing an additional layer of filtration for better air quality. They can improve total health and well-being by reducing airborne contaminants.


Smart thermostats and zoning methods play a vital function in enhancing the functionality of HVAC units. Smart thermostats permit owners to manage temperature settings remotely and be taught user habits for more energy-efficient operation. Zoning methods allow completely different areas of the home to be heated or cooled according to individual preferences, optimizing comfort and energy use.

When selecting an indoor HVAC unit, it is crucial to contemplate factors such as power efficiency, measurement, and the particular heating and cooling wants of your own home. System efficiency is often indicated by the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ER) for cooling and the Annual Fuel Utilization Efficiency (AFUE) score for heating methods. A greater score signifies higher efficiency view it now and lower operational costs.
